30 /*!
31 * \file bbuffer.h
32 *
33 * <pre>
34 * Expandable byte buffer for reading data in from memory and
35 * writing data out to other memory.
36 *
37 * This implements a queue of bytes, so data read in is put
38 * on the "back" of the queue (i.e., the end of the byte array)
39 * and data written out is taken from the "front" of the queue
40 * (i.e., from an index marker "nwritten" that is initially set at
41 * the beginning of the array.) As usual with expandable
42 * arrays, we keep the size of the allocated array and the
43 * number of bytes that have been read into the array.
44 *
45 * For implementation details, see bbuffer.c.
46 * </pre>
47 */
48
49 /*! Expandable byte buffer for memory read/write operations */
50 struct L_ByteBuffer
51 {
52 l_int32 nalloc; /*!< size of allocated byte array */
53 l_int32 n; /*!< number of bytes read into to the array */
54 l_int32 nwritten; /*!< number of bytes written from the array */
55 l_uint8 *array; /*!< byte array */
56 };
57 typedef struct L_ByteBuffer L_BBUFFER;
